Output 0269a97cef2123d81cda0f10252907a39d4f9724d6b7c4301f8a131cc73b7bfc:0

value
40532318
script pubkey
OP_HASH160 OP_PUSHBYTES_20 296b5e88e3eff3d2a255e4a7b662f751f038fd54 OP_EQUAL
address
35U2FZFfxxFpve6ubpNnPtfsJUMvSmN7FU
transaction
0269a97cef2123d81cda0f10252907a39d4f9724d6b7c4301f8a131cc73b7bfc
spent
true